Tommaso Bianchi 56eebe3398 kernel-test: stop configuring the GUI, which the kernel suite never needed
This script builds only libslic3r_tests, which links libslic3r and no GUI code —
but cmake still processed the whole if(SLIC3R_GUI) block and every find_package
inside it, so the kernel suite silently depended on the GUI's dependency set.

That came due the moment upstream added wxInspector as a REQUIRED find_package:
the orcacad-deps image predates it, so configure died pointing at
src/CMakeLists.txt:92 with nothing about the kernel having changed. Turning the
block off is not a workaround for that one dependency — it is the suite finally
declaring what it actually needs, so the next GUI-side dependency added upstream
cannot break it either.

Surfaced by taking SoftFever's merge of main into the PR branch.
